How to Make Fruit Salad in Disney Dreamlight Valley

To make Fruit Salad in Disney Dreamlight Valley, you only need to use one fruit. It doesn’t matter what exactly you use. Put one Banana, Apple, Raspberry, or any other fruit into the pan and press the Start Cooking button. You will also need one coal, but you can get it using your Pickaxe on Blackstones in any region in the game.

It is worth noting that the fruit you choose will not affect the finished dish. Whether you use an Apple or a Banana, your dish will not receive any additional bonuses. You can get most fruits at the beginning of the game in Peaceful Meadow. Therefore, it makes no sense for you to look for ingredients in later locations.

Once you make Fruit Salad, you can eat it for 450 energy points. Or you can sell the finished dish in Goofy Stall for 25 Star Coin. It’s not a lot of money, but it’s a little more than you could get by selling an Apple. In addition, you will need to make Fruit Salad to complete the Peacemakers quest. And for this quest, you also need to cook Seafood Salad and Seafood Platter.

If you’re new to Disney Dreamlight Valley, you’ll also need to unlock Chez Remy. And once you do, you can find the Fruit Salad recipe near the right wall of the restaurant. Use the shovel to dig up the recipe from the ground.
